{"product_id":"rq7747","title":"Sorting nexin 18 Antibody \/ SNX18","description":"\u003cp\u003eSorting nexin-18 is a protein that in humans is encoded by the SNX18 gene. This gene encodes a member of the sorting nexin family. Members of this family contain a phox (PX) domain, which is a phosphoinositide binding domain, and are involved in intracellular trafficking. This protein does not contain a coiled coil region, like some family members, but contains a SH3 domain. Multiple trans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"NSJ Bioreagents","offers":[{"title":"100 ug \/ Rabbit","offer_id":49475404202264,"sku":"RQ7747","price":439.0,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0590\/5652\/1400\/files\/get_image_4f5a88fe-9e94-4029-88ed-6c32b9a26250.jpg?v=1734448407","url":"https:\/\/danabiosci.com\/products\/rq7747","provider":"Dana Bioscience","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
